SQLWorkbenchPackage Classe

Définition

Important

Cette API n’est pas conforme CLS.

public ref class SQLWorkbenchPackage abstract : IDisposable, IServiceProvider, Microsoft::VisualStudio::OLE::Interop::IOleCommandTarget, Microsoft::VisualStudio::Shell::Interop::IVsPackage, System::ComponentModel::Design::IServiceContainer, System::ComponentModel::IContainer
[System.CLSCompliant(false)]
[System.Runtime.InteropServices.ComVisible(true)]
public abstract class SQLWorkbenchPackage : IDisposable, IServiceProvider, Microsoft.VisualStudio.OLE.Interop.IOleCommandTarget, Microsoft.VisualStudio.Shell.Interop.IVsPackage, System.ComponentModel.Design.IServiceContainer, System.ComponentModel.IContainer
[<System.CLSCompliant(false)>]
[<System.Runtime.InteropServices.ComVisible(true)>]
type SQLWorkbenchPackage = class
    interface IContainer
    interface IDisposable
    interface IVsPackage
    interface Utils.IOleServiceProvider
    interface IOleCommandTarget
    interface IServiceContainer
    interface IServiceProvider
Public MustInherit Class SQLWorkbenchPackage
Implements IContainer, IDisposable, IOleCommandTarget, IServiceContainer, IServiceProvider, IVsPackage
Héritage
SQLWorkbenchPackage
Dérivé
Attributs
Implémente

Constructeurs

SQLWorkbenchPackage()
SQLWorkbenchPackage(SQLWorkbenchPackage+OptionsPage[])

Champs

trALWAYS
trERR
trL1
trL2
trWARN

Propriétés

Components
GlobalCommandTargets

Méthodes

Add(IComponent)
Add(IComponent, String)
AddService(Type, Object)
AddService(Type, Object, Boolean)
AddService(Type, ServiceCreatorCallback)
AddService(Type, ServiceCreatorCallback, Boolean)
Close()
CreateTool(Guid)
Dispose()
Dispose(Boolean)
GetAutomationObject(String, Object)
GetOptionPage(String)
GetPropertyPage(Guid, VSPROPSHEETPAGE[])
GetService(Type)
GetSite()
OnServiceCreated(Type, Object)
QueryClose(Int32)
Remove(IComponent)
RemoveService(Type)
RemoveService(Type, Boolean)
ResetDefaults(UInt32)
SetSite(IServiceProvider)

Implémentations d’interfaces explicites

IOleCommandTarget.Exec(Guid, UInt32, UInt32, IntPtr, IntPtr)
IOleCommandTarget.QueryStatus(Guid, UInt32, OLECMD[], IntPtr)
IServiceProvider.GetService(Type)

S’applique à